Output 84cb28343d2d4a08e0f50d4a3b9944fe5f4335f0baa1ed0232a75e75780f0448:3

value
687498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29085a98705d304ea5029f67fd4c7b22764bc3dd OP_EQUAL
address
35Rydr65CDVihk659KDzyYoBd9e1TocPgM
transaction
84cb28343d2d4a08e0f50d4a3b9944fe5f4335f0baa1ed0232a75e75780f0448
spent
true